Where to stay in Shanghai?
Choosing the right accommodation is crucial to your travel experience. There are many options available in Shanghai ranging from budget-friendly hostels to luxurious hotels. Depending on your budget and preferences, you can choose to stay in the historic French Concession area or near popular attractions like People's Square.
What to see in Shanghai?
Shanghai is home to numerous iconic landmarks such as the Oriental Pearl Tower and the Bund. The Bund offers stunning views of the Huangpu River and Pudong skyline while the Oriental Pearl Tower provides panoramic views of the city from its observation decks.
How to get around in Shanghai?
Shanghai has an efficient public transportation system including buses and metro lines that cover most areas of the city. You can also take taxis or ride-hailing services if you prefer door-to-door service.

Tips for visiting during peak season
If you're planning a trip during peak season (June-August), be prepared for larger crowds at popular tourist sites but don't let it dampen your spirits! Try visiting early morning before 10 am when possible so avoid peak hours rush especially if going up any skyscrapers!
